sounds like the shutter buffer is disintergrating.
Have a look at the shutter blades - if you see any "black gunk" on them then the only way to fix it is to strip the camera and clean all traces of the gunk from the shutter.
I've fixed many of these in my time - it's a common Canon fault with EOS and some T series shutters
